Haverford kept a clean sheet against Strath Haven on Thursday. They blew past the Panthers 4-0. The match marked Haverford's most dominant victory of the season.
Haverford's win bumped their record up to 6-2-1. As for Strath Haven, they have been struggling recently as they've lost four of their last five contests. That's put a noticeable dent in their 3-4-1 record this season.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Haverford will take on Springfield at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Haverford will be up against Springfield's rather soft defense (which has allowed 2.88 goals per game), so fans could be in store for a big offensive performance. As for Strath Haven, they will host Great Valley at 2:00 p.m. on Saturday. Great Valley's last four matches have been decided by no more than a goal, so don't be surprised if it's a close one.
